Antique Floral Wool Hand Knotted Pile Blue 1920s Rug, Circa Date: 1920s. This exceptional example of early 20th-century Chinese Art Deco weaving features the characteristic open field and dramatic use of negative space, emphasizing the delicate floral rugs that define the composition.
The central field is dominated by a rich, saturated indigo, creating a striking contrast against the vibrant pinks, blues, and golds used for the sparse ornamentation. This deep hue places it among the most sought-after blue color rugs from the period, providing a sophisticated foundation for any interior space.
A stylized bird, likely a phoenix, perches gracefully on a flowering branch, rendered with meticulous detail and a luxurious, high pile. The superb condition and clarity of design confirm its status as a fine example among high-quality antique rugs of the Art Deco era.
